PGEC: The Terence Mortimer Postgraduate Centre

A large Edwardian house with its own car park which was converted and opened in 1975. It is located on the hospital site but within its own large garden with access both from the hospital and the main Oxford Road which makes it accessible for both hospital and external users.

The Centre's position near to the M40 gives easy access to Oxford, London, Birmingham, Warwick, Stratford-upon-Avon, and the Cotswolds. The surroundings are ideal for creating informal and productive meetings and over the years has led to close co-operation between all grades of medical, dental, nursing and paramedical professions.

The facilities consist of:

A lecture hall to seat 70 delegates, a versatile room with retractable tiered seating.

Two seminar rooms each with seating capacity for 10 - 14 people.

A Common room, including a bar area, with excellent catering, armchairs and television.

Equipment:

The Centre has the latest audio-visual equipment including video-projector, visualiser, projecting microscope, image scanner and digital cameras.
